The Importance Of Talent Recruiters In Today’s Job Market

In today’s competitive job market, the role of talent recruiters has become more important than ever. Also known as talent acquisition specialists or headhunters, these professionals play a crucial role in helping companies find the best candidates for their open positions. Companies rely on talent recruiters to source, screen, and select candidates who possess the skills, experience, and cultural fit needed to drive the organization forward.

One of the main reasons why talent recruiters are in such high demand is the sheer volume of job seekers in the market. With so many candidates vying for a limited number of positions, companies need help filtering through resumes and identifying the most qualified individuals. By partnering with talent recruiters, companies can save time and resources by letting them handle the initial screening process.

talent recruiters also bring a level of expertise and industry knowledge that can be invaluable to companies. Unlike internal HR departments, talent recruiters specialize in finding top talent across a wide range of industries and job functions. This expertise allows them to quickly identify potential candidates who meet the specific requirements of the position, saving companies the time and effort required to do so themselves.

In addition, talent recruiters have access to a vast network of candidates that may not be actively searching for a job but are open to new opportunities. These passive candidates are often highly qualified individuals who are not actively looking for a new job but may be tempted by the right opportunity. talent recruiters know how to reach out to these passive candidates and sell them on the benefits of the open position, increasing the pool of potential candidates for companies to choose from.

Furthermore, talent recruiters are skilled in assessing candidates beyond just their qualifications and experience. They are experts at conducting behavioral interviews, reference checks, and background screenings to ensure that the candidates they recommend are not only qualified but also a good cultural fit for the company. This insight is crucial in reducing turnover and ensuring that the new hire will succeed in the role.

Another advantage of working with talent recruiters is their ability to streamline the hiring process. They can coordinate interviews, negotiate offers, and facilitate the onboarding process, saving companies valuable time and resources. This allows companies to focus on their core business activities while leaving the recruitment process in the hands of experts.

For job seekers, talent recruiters can also be a valuable resource in their job search. By partnering with a talent recruiter, job seekers gain access to exclusive job opportunities that may not be advertised publicly. talent recruiters can also provide valuable feedback on resume writing, interviewing skills, and professional development, helping job seekers stand out from the competition.
